Why Water Purifier Servicing Matters in Kolkata

Kolkata's municipal water supply carries a range of dissolved solids, microbial contaminants, and heavy metals that make direct consumption unsafe. RO (Reverse Osmosis) purifiers work hard every day to filter these impurities, and over time, the internal components — especially the membrane and filters — lose their effectiveness. A poorly maintained purifier may actually deliver worse water than no purifier at all, because a clogged or degraded membrane can harbour bacteria and bypass filtration altogether.

This is exactly why residents across the city regularly search for RO service in Kolkata — not just when something breaks, but as part of a proactive maintenance routine. Regular servicing keeps your purifier delivering safe, clean water day after day.

Common RO Water Purifier Problems You Should Never Ignore

Most purifier problems do not happen overnight. They develop gradually and often show clear warning signs before they become serious. Here are the most frequent issues that call for immediate attention:

•        RO slow water flow: If your purifier is taking unusually long to fill a glass, it is a strong sign that the membrane is clogged or the pre-filters are saturated. This is one of the most common complaints reported by users and requires prompt filter inspection.

•        RO bad taste water: A change in the taste or smell of purified water often means the activated carbon filter is exhausted or the membrane has been compromised. Do not continue drinking from the unit until a technician inspects it.

•        Purifier not working: A completely non-functional unit may have a faulty motor, a tripped circuit, a damaged solenoid valve, or a dead SMPS (power supply). These require professional diagnosis — do not attempt to fix electrical faults on your own.

•        Water leakage: Leaking around the unit's body, fittings, or storage tank should never be left unattended, as it wastes water and can cause electrical hazards.

•        High TDS output: If the purified water consistently shows high TDS (Total Dissolved Solids) on a meter, the RO membrane needs immediate replacement. This is the core filtration component and should be checked at least once a year.

Key Services Offered by a Professional RO Technician

A qualified water purifier technician does much more than just clean the exterior of your unit. When you book a water purifier service in Kolkata, a certified professional covers every aspect of your system, including:

•        RO membrane replacement: The membrane is the heart of any RO system. It typically lasts 12 to 24 months depending on your water quality and usage. A technician tests membrane performance and replaces it if TDS rejection has fallen below the safe threshold.

•        RO filter change: Pre-filters (sediment and carbon) and post-filters require periodic replacement — usually every 6 to 12 months. Skipping a filter change forces the membrane to handle more impurities than it was designed for, drastically reducing its lifespan.

•        Full system sanitisation and tank cleaning to eliminate bacteria and biofilm buildup.

•        Inspection and testing of the booster pump, solenoid valve, and float valve.

•        TDS calibration and output water quality testing before wrapping up.

Understanding RO Service Charges and What You Pay For

Many homeowners hesitate to call a technician because they worry about hidden costs. Being informed about RO service charges helps you make better decisions. In Kolkata, a standard service visit typically covers labour, a basic inspection, and minor cleaning. Additional costs apply for part replacements such as the membrane, filters, pump, or tank. Always ask for an itemised estimate before the technician begins any replacement work. Reputable service providers offer transparent pricing with no surprise charges after the job is done.

For those who want full cost predictability, AMC plans for water purifiers — Annual Maintenance Contracts — are an excellent option. These plans typically cover multiple service visits per year, filter replacements, labour charges, and sometimes even membrane replacement, all bundled at a fixed annual fee.

Why an AMC Plan Makes Sense for Kolkata Residents

Given Kolkata's water conditions — which often include high sediment load, seasonal fluctuations in quality, and varying hardness — purifiers in this city tend to work harder than those in areas with better source water. This means filters and membranes deplete faster, and the risk of a breakdown is higher without regular attention. An AMC plan water purifier subscription ensures your machine receives scheduled servicing without you needing to remember or chase a technician every few months. It also gives you priority support when something unexpected goes wrong, along with RO service warranty cover on replaced parts — saving you from bearing the full cost of another replacement in case a component fails prematurely.

RO Repair Service Kolkata: When Your Purifier Needs More Than a Service

Sometimes a standard service visit is not enough. If your purifier has suffered a major component failure — such as a burnt motor, a cracked storage tank, a damaged circuit board, or a broken pressure pump — you need dedicated RO repair service Kolkata. Repair work goes beyond cleaning and filter changes. It involves diagnosing the root cause of failure, sourcing the correct replacement part, and restoring the system to factory-grade performance. Always insist that the technician performs a post-repair water quality test before concluding the visit. This confirms the repair was successful and gives you peace of mind.

If your purifier is more than five years old and requires frequent repairs, it may be time to weigh the cost of ongoing RO repair Kolkata visits against the investment in a new unit. A trusted service provider can help you make this assessment honestly.
